Both belong to the broader class of antihistamines, medications that block histamine H1 receptors to reduce allergic symptoms. The core question isn’t just “which one works,” but “which one matches your daily routine, side‑effect tolerance, and treatment goal.” The comparison Promethazine vs diphenhydramine encompasses sedation levels, onset speed, duration of action, and safety in specific populations. For example, higher sedation intensity often steers patients toward nighttime use, while a quicker onset may be crucial for acute allergic reactions. Understanding these nuances lets you match the right drug to the right scenario without guessing.
Let’s break down the main attributes. Sedation, the drowsy feeling many users experience is markedly stronger with Promethazine; it’s a go‑to for motion sickness and as a pre‑operative sleep aid. Diphenhydramine also causes drowsiness, but the effect is milder and tends to wear off faster, making it a popular over‑the‑counter sleep aid. Allergy relief, the ability to curb itching, sneezing, and hives is comparable for mild to moderate reactions, yet Promethazine’s longer half‑life provides more sustained control for chronic conditions. Onset time differs too: Diphenhydramine often begins working within 15‑30 minutes, while Promethazine may need 30‑60 minutes to hit peak effect. Duration follows the same pattern—Promethazine can last 6‑8 hours, versus 4‑6 hours for Diphenhydramine. Safety considerations add another layer: both drugs cross the blood‑brain barrier, but Promethazine carries a higher risk of anticholinergic side effects such as dry mouth, blurred vision, and urinary retention, especially in older adults. Diphenhydramine’s anticholinergic burden is lower but still present, so caution is advised for anyone taking multiple sedating meds.
Practical takeaways: choose Promethazine when you need strong sedation, longer coverage, or an anti‑nausea effect—think travel sickness, pre‑surgery preparation, or severe allergic flare‑ups that last beyond a few hours. Opt for Diphenhydramine when you want a milder, quicker‑acting antihistamine that can double as an occasional sleep aid without lingering grogginess the next day. Always consider personal health factors—age, liver function, concurrent medications—and discuss with a healthcare provider before starting either drug.
